Default Orion vortex on Mamba problem

Hey,

Got a new Vortex 6.5 yesterday, fitted it to my B4, hard wired to my mamba ESC, when i pull away it jsut sits there and judders, not going anywhere, yet give it a nudge and its fine, fantastic even.

Any ideas on whats wrong? is it a dodgey motor or dodgey settings on the speedo?

I would plug the esc into the pc and set to original settings, then also make sure the settings are on normal for the timing instead of high (as this setting is for mamba motors only). It should work then, as I had the same problem with my Peak brushless motor and went through the setting proceedure on the pc and it now is a missile. also check the screws as well as they can hit the fan at the front of the motor and make it stop as well, so you need to either put smaller ones on or a metal heat sink plate in front of the motor

Ive had a play with the computer settings today and found that if you set the start power to high and turn the timing on the motor so the letter 'B' on the endbell is under the 'C' tab it works very well, just hope it stays like that
